Following particulars has been shared for you. If fixed cost is Rs500000, selling price is Rs60 and Variable cost is Rs20

a. Calculate and describe -Breakeven point (5 Marks)

b. What could be the sales number to earn a profit of Rs 50000, at a Fixed Cost Rs 200000, Variable Cost Rs30 per unit, Selling Price Rs 60 per unit (5 Marks)

a.Break- even point== Fixed Costs÷(÷( Sales per unit- Variable cost per unit))

=Rs500000÷(6020)=Rs500000÷(60-20)

=12,500= 12,500 units
